DESCRIPTION:REGISTER \nAustralian Culinary Federation – South Queensland Branch\nTruffle Experience & Members Camping Weekend\nThe Folly Truffles\n1110 Bents Rd\, Ballandean QLD\n Sunday\, 3 August 2025\n________________________________________Event Schedule\n11:30 AM – 2:30 PM\nSocial Brunch Meeting\nFolly Truffles Camping Ground\nTruffle Brunch Items Included\n(Casual gathering and catch-up for members and guests. Bring along your own camping chair.)\n3:00 PM – 4:30 PM\nTruffle Experience\nJoin us for an intimate and immersive tour of the truffière. Learn about truffle growing\, and follow Barry the truffle dog through the trees as he sniffs out hidden treasures. You’ll witness the truffle harvest first-hand and enjoy a tasting of beautifully prepared truffle dishes to complete the afternoon.\n________________________________________\n🎟️ Booking Details\n•	Members & Partners: $50.00\n•	Non-Members: $90.00\n•	Children: Free\n________________________________________\n Members Camping Weekend\nMake a weekend of it!\nCamping is available onsite at The Folly. Off-grid and eco-friendly\, the campground offers peaceful surroundings\, scenic views\, and ample space between sites. Each site features a level gravel pad and an outdoor fire pit (conditions permitting). Well-behaved pets on leads are welcome.\nTo book your campsite\, contact The Folly directly:\nthefollyballandean.com.au\n________________________________________\nThe Folly Truffles is located approximately 3 hours south of Brisbane and 30 minutes from Stanthorpe.

DESCRIPTION:DETAILS & REGISTRATION \nAn Unforgettable Culinary Experience with a Cause \nStep into a world reimagined. On Friday the 13th of June\, you’re invited to a bold and immersive dining experience designed to raise funds for global and local disaster relief initiatives. \nSupported by: \n\nAustralian Culinary Federation – South Queensland (ACFSQ)\nAustralian Culinary Federation – South Queensland Young Chefs (ACFSQ)\nRotary Redcliffe Sunrise\n\nIn Support of: \n\nWorld Chefs Without Borders — Global humanitarian culinary aid\nShelterBox Australia — Emergency shelter and tools for families in crisis\nGIVIT — Supporting vulnerable Australians in need\nACFSQ – Young Chefs\n\nWhat to Expect \nA Four-Course Adventure\nSample a daring\, chef-designed menu that transforms humble\, international disaster relief staples into gourmet creations. Indulge in locally-sourced\, sustainable proteins — these are not your typical fine dining dishes. \nThoughtful Beverage Pairings\nEnjoy non-alcoholic beverage pairings across the meal\, with beer and wine supplements available. \nLive Online Auction\nBid on exclusive culinary experiences and rare food-related items. All proceeds go directly to our partner charities. \nThe Setting\nTraverse rubble\, descend into the “disaster zone\,” and dine in a stark\, immersive environment designed to evoke the urgency and resilience of those affected by crisis. As the theme warns:\n“Beware\, anything can happen on Friday the 13th.”\n\nFeatured Menu Highlights\nCanapés: Paired with mulled red wine and watermelon beer \n· Entrée (by ACFSQ Young Chefs): Paired with nettle iced tea and white wine \n· Main (Vegan with a twist): Paired with non-alcoholic Pimm’s and red wine (with a surprise unsustainable beef treat on the side) \n· Dessert: Paired with decaffeinated non-alcoholic Irish coffee\n \nBookings\nJoin the social tables for an interactive evening with like-minded people — or book a full table and take your friends on a journey. \n\nSocial Tables: $95.00 (gst incl)per person + BF (gst Incl)\nTables of Eight: $720.00 + BF (gst Incl)
